Just received October 3rd class invitation email. (my interview was in May for reference...)

Some interesting information from the class invite email -
  • This will be a passenger only class. No 330F slots.
  • Next 330 freighter only class is expected to be very late 2023 or early 2024.
  • You can choose to wait for freighter only class if you want.
Very excited to finally have a firm date

Just finished up my first week of indoc here at Hawaiian Airlines. I'm loving it so far! I'm one of the 7 cargo guys in the class. In the freighter class, two of us came from ABX and ATI. The others were regional pilots and one part 135 pilot. The passenger side originally had 10 scheduled to attend, but one got moved to a later class date. Passenger airframe breakdown was:
1 A330P
4 A321
4 717
Looking forward to seeing y'all down the line!
